What is imagination?

Imagination is visual-figurative, during which a person presents specific images in his head. They may be of a different nature.

  • There are images-memories, when a person returns to what happened to him, he again scrolls in his head what happened to him.
  • There are images-dreams - when a person imagines in his head the desired pictures of the future in which he would like to be.
  • There are images of oneself when a person begins to imagine or try to understand who he is.
  • There are images of the real world, when a person simply remembers what he saw or heard.
  • There are fantasy images when a person begins to create new objects or phenomena that do not yet exist in nature.

Imagination becomes multifaceted and multifunctional. It allows you to predict further development events based on previous experience. It helps to create where main point it becomes the creation of something new and unusual. It allows you to influence your mood and even motivate yourself. Often imagination allows you to understand how to act in a situation in order to achieve the desired result.

Imagination uses the memory of a person who has certain experiences, knowledge and memories. Creative thinking is also used, which may include the ability of a person to think of things they have never seen or heard. In psychology, the following functions of imagination are distinguished:

  1. Cognitive - imagination helps to systematize information, to better understand it and highlight something new for yourself.
  2. Forecasting - a person is able to imagine in his head how events will unfold, what the final result will be.
  3. Understanding - by imagining, a person can guess what another individual is thinking and feeling.
  4. Self-development - a person fantasizes and predicts, which makes him stronger and more self-confident.
  5. Protection - if a person can predict events, then he can prepare for them.
  6. Memories - the ability to reproduce what a person has already experienced.

Imagination manifests itself in various forms. The most famous are:

  • - the creation of new forms, objects, phenomena on the basis of really existing ones, which a person transforms in his mind.
  • Emphasis - fixing attention on a particular characteristic of an object.
  • Typification is the selection of certain features in several subjects.

Types of imagination

Imagination is divided into the following types:

  1. Involuntary (passive) - when a person simply thinks about something, even without always taking a conscious part in it. This often happens in a state of half-asleep or drowsiness.
  2. Arbitrary (active) - a person consciously turns on the process of imagination and imagines some images.
  3. Dreams are a vision of a desired future.
  4. Recreation - when a person reproduces in his head what really exists.
  5. Creativity - when a person actively creates a certain phenomenon, object or image in his head, which is not in reality.

Imagination in psychology

The human brain is able not only to perceive and remember information, but also to perform all kinds of operations with it. In ancient times, primitive people were at first completely similar to animals: they got food and built primitive dwellings. But human abilities have evolved. And one fine day, people realized that it is much more difficult to hunt an animal with bare hands than with the help of special devices. Scratching their heads, the savages sat down and invented a spear, a bow and arrows, an axe. All these objects, before they were created, were embodied in the form of images in human brain. This process is called imagination.

People developed, and at the same time the ability to mentally create images, completely new and on the basis of existing ones, improved. Not only thoughts, but also desires and aspirations were formed on this foundation. Based on this, it can be argued that imagination in psychology is one of the processes of cognition of the surrounding reality. This is an imprint of the outside world in the subconscious. It allows not only to imagine the future, to program it, but also to remember the past.

In addition, the definition of imagination in psychology can be formulated in another way. For example, it is often called the ability to mentally represent an absent object or phenomenon, manipulate it in one's mind, and retain its image. Often imagination is confused with perception. But psychologists argue that these cognitive functions of the brain are fundamentally different. Unlike perception, imagination creates images based on memory, and not on the outside world, and it is also less real, as it often contains elements of dreams and fantasy.

The main ways of creating images

There are several of them, but each of them characterizes the concept of imagination in psychology as a rather complex, multi-level process.

  1. Agglutination. Evaluating and analyzing the qualities, properties and appearance of an object, we create in our imagination a new, sometimes bizarre image, far from reality. For example, in this way the fairy-tale character Centaur (a human body and horse legs), as well as Baba Yaga's hut (a house and chicken legs), an elf (a human image and insect wings) were invented in this way. As a rule, a similar technique is used when creating myths and legends.
  2. Accent. Isolation in a person, object or activity of a single dominant characteristic and its hyperbolization. This method is actively used by artists during the creation of caricatures and cartoons.
  3. Typing. The most complex method, based on highlighting the features of several objects and creating a new, composite image from them. So come up literary heroes, characters of fairy tales.

These are the basic techniques of imagination in psychology. Their result is already existing material, but transformed and modified. active imagination

Usually there are such types of imagination in psychology: active and passive. They differ not only in their internal content, but also in the main forms of their manifestation. Active imagination is the conscious construction of various images in your mind, solving problems and recreating connections between subjects. One of the ways it manifests itself is fantasy. For example, an author writes a script for a film. He invents a story based on real facts, embellished with fictional details. The flight of thought can lead so far that in the end what is written turns out to be phantasmagoric and virtually impossible.

An example of fantasy is any action movie in cinema: the elements real life here are present (weapons, drugs, criminal authorities) along with exaggerated characteristics of the characters (their invincibility, the ability to survive under the onslaught of hundreds of attacking hooligans). Fantasy manifests itself not only during creativity, but also in ordinary life. We often mentally reproduce human capabilities that are unrealistic, but so desirable: the ability to become invisible, fly, breathe underwater. Imagination and fantasy in psychology are closely interconnected. Often they result in productive creativity or ordinary dreams.

A special manifestation of active imagination is a dream - the mental creation of images of the future. So, we often imagine what our house by the sea will look like, what car we will buy with the accumulated money, what we will name the children and what they will become when they grow up. It differs from fantasy in its reality, earthiness. A dream can always come true, the main thing is to apply all your efforts and skills to this.

passive imagination

These are images that visit our consciousness involuntarily. We do not put any effort into this: they arise spontaneously, have both real and fantastic content. by the most a prime example passive imagination are our dreams - an imprint of what was previously seen or heard, our fears and desires, feelings and aspirations. During "night movies" we can see possible scenarios for the development of certain events (a quarrel with loved ones, a disaster, the birth of a child) or absolutely fantastic scenes (an incomprehensible kaleidoscope of unrelated images and actions).

By the way, the last type of visions, provided that a waking person sees it, is called a hallucination. This is also passive imagination. In psychology, there are several reasons for this condition: severe head trauma, alcohol or drug intoxication, intoxication. Hallucinations have nothing to do with real life, they are often completely fantastic, even insane visions.

In addition to active and passive, one can also distinguish the following types of imagination in psychology:

  • Productive. Creation of completely new ideas and images as a result of creative activity.
  • Reproductive. Recreating pictures according to existing schemes, graphs and illustrative examples.
